Mattityahu 6:30-34 Orthodox Jewish Bible (OJB)

30. And if Hashem thus clothes the grass of the field that exists today and tomorrow is thrown into a furnace, how much more will he clothe you, you ones of little emunah?

31. Therefore, do not have a LEV ROGEZ (DEVARIM 28:65), saying, What might we eat? or What might we drink? or With what might we clothe ourselves?

32. For all these things the Goyim strive. For your Av shbaShomayim bavorn (anticipates) that you need all these things.

33. But seek first the Malchut Hashem and the Tzidkat Hashem, and all these things will be added to you.

34. Therefore, do not have a LEV ROGEZ (DEVARIM 28:65) for tomorrow, for makhar (tomorrow) will care for itself. Each day has enough tzoros of its own.
